What is required for a prospective transfer student coming from another post-secondary institution?

The University of Guelph uses the word "Transfer" to refer to an applicant or new student who has previously attended (or who is currently enrolled in) a post-secondary institution (college or university) other than the University of Guelph. Students considering applying to Transfer to the University of Guelph from another institution should refer to the University/College Transfer information under Admission Information on the Admission Services [1] website.
